Etymologically "выдержка" derives from the verb "держать" (to hold).
Meanings of выдержка:

1) self-control, self-mastery, self-restraint
2) tenacity; staying power, endurance
3) ripening, ag(e)ing (about wine)
вино двухлетней выдержки — two-year-old wine
4) (photo) exposure
5) extract, excerpt, quotation

All of them are widely used in modern Russian.
